The stamped steel sections of your factory frame can flex under load, impacting the rearend geometry. BMR's Control Arm Reinforcement Braces (RB002) are engineered to combat this issue. By attaching to the inner upper and lower control arm mounts, these braces significantly enhance the strength of the areas most susceptible to deflection.
Whether you're hitting the streets or the track, these reinforcement braces provide the additional strength your rear suspension needs for a more responsive driving experience. They eliminate flex, ensuring better repeatability whether you're accelerating from a standstill or navigating tight corners. Plus, they maintain acceptable NVH levels, so you won’t have to sacrifice ride quality for performance.

How It StartedBMR Suspension is an aftermarket company that specializes in creating suspension parts for various American muscle cars. The company started in 1998 and has since provided enthusiasts with an affordable option for aftermarket suspension parts.
They may not be as old as some of the tenured suspension manufacturers in the world, but the company does not fall short when it comes to delivering quality products to its customers. Today, they have become the go-to brand for suspension upgrades and have a comprehensive list of parts for a wide range of vehicle applications.
Proudly Made in the USABMR products are 100% made in the USA at their manufacturing facility in Tampa, Florida. They use high-quality Chromoly steel, which is strong and durable. These are the same materials used in the roll cages of race cars.
All of BMR’s products are fixture-welded to avoid any deformation, ensuring that all the end products are within specification. Since their manufacturing process is done in-house, the company is able to maintain its level of quality.
